Roger Cheng / CNET:
Verizon eliminates subsidized phones and contracts, offers 4 plans with 1-12GB of data for $30-80 per month and a $20 per month smartphone access fee  —  Verizon kills off service contracts, smartphone subsidies  —  In a radical shift, the company will only offer new plans …

Daniel Veditz / Mozilla Security Blog:
Firefox file-stealing exploit found in the wild, Mozilla issues security update patching the vulnerability  —  Firefox exploit found in the wild  —  Yesterday morning, August 5, a Firefox user informed us that an advertisement on a news site in Russia was serving a Firefox exploit that searched …
Thomas Mulier / Bloomberg Business:
NPD: Apple helped US watch sales fall 14% in June, the biggest drop in seven years  —  Apple Helps Push U.S. Watch Sales to Biggest Drop in Seven Years  —  U.S. watch sales fell the most in seven years in June, one of the first signs Apple Inc.'s watch is eroding demand for traditional timepieces.
